Transaction 865ccfbd24d0d9f4b03de1d4b5a933bc00a8e56ca0009492eff1f6f70a39c4ad

block
165aae5afe338e741669521a04881e0a94a916292d9a02756ffa61cfe305a0d9

1 Input

19 Outputs